Finally fixed the top thread tension problem. It was not the top thread, nor the tension discs, nor the needle, nor the threading, and neither was accumulated lint in the feed dogs area.
It was the tiniest piece of broken thread trapped between the bobbin case spring and the rest of the bobbin case. Exactly the thing that regulates the bobbin tension.

Picking a lining fabric is a little bit like matchmaking! 💞⁠

You want to pick a lining that goes with your main fabric- for example, a silky rayon bemberg is a perfect match for this medium-weight wool coating. For a cotton eyelet, a smooth and lightweight cotton fabric would complement it well. For a rain jacket, a removable flannel lining might be just the thing!⁠

Are you traveling this holiday season? ✈️🚗🧳 Bring your sewing with you!⁠

We know, holiday visits are usually pretty busy. But if you can squeeze a little bit of sewing in during the quieter moments, it might make the difference between frazzled and festive. Sewing is such a nice brain reset. Here are a few ideas for bringing your sewing along with you:⁠

🪡 Hand sewing takes up a lot less space than machine sewing. Do some hand finishing on a garment - or do some of the construction steps by hand! It can really improve your skills. ⁠

🪡 Embellish your me-mades or thrift finds with hand embroidery.⁠

🪡 Try out a new hand sewing technique like applique or hexie quilting.⁠

🪡 Bring your machine along and work on whatever makes your heart sing.⁠

How to cut and press double gauze (without losing those lovely crinkles!): ⁠

Step 1: Pre-wash and dry your fabric.⁠

Step 2: Use a steamy iron to remove any major folds. Either lift and set down the iron on those spots (not running it over the fabric) or just use the steam and finger press the big folds out. Try to preserve the crinkly texture as much as you can!⁠

Step 3: Cut out your pattern pieces!⁠

Keeping the crinkles in will give you a better idea of how the final garment will fit. Use your iron minimally, or just finger press it! Part of the beauty of double gauze is crinkliness, so it makes sense to work with it. ⁠
